Mercedes has introduced software changes ahead of this weekend's Hungarian Grand Prix after identifying the cause of the power deployment issues that severely affected George Russell during the Belgian Grand Prix.

Russell struggled throughout last weekend with a noticeable straight-line speed deficit compared to team-mate Kimi Antonelli, costing him several tenths of a second per lap in qualifying.

The problem also played a major role in his first-lap retirement after contact with Lewis Hamilton, prompting the Briton to describe the situation over team radio as "unacceptable."

Following an in-depth investigation, Mercedes discovered the root cause was buried within the power unit's software.

An issue in the deployment code caused Russell's battery energy to be used too aggressively during the opening part of the lap, particularly on the run towards Les Combes.

Combined with differences in driving style and energy harvesting compared to Antonelli, Russell was left with reduced battery power on the approach to the final chicane.

Mercedes has now implemented software countermeasures for Hungary to prevent the issue from recurring.

The team is also optimistic that the Hungaroring's layout, which places fewer demands on energy deployment than Spa, should naturally reduce the impact of similar problems.

The Brackley squad also uncovered the cause of the deployment issues both drivers experienced at the start of the Belgian Grand Prix.

A software error prevented the cars from harvesting as much energy as expected into La Source, while additional battery usage to offset turbo lag further reduced available power along the Kemmel Straight.

Although both drivers were affected, they experienced different outcomes. Russell remained flat through Eau Rouge, leaving him restricted to a lower deployment mode and a top speed of around 308km/h.

Antonelli, however, briefly lifted after being overtaken by Max Verstappen, placing his power unit in a different operating mode that allowed slightly greater deployment.

Despite still suffering reduced power, Antonelli carried enough speed to slipstream back past Verstappen and reclaim the lead.
